I have a new bio cube 14 as some as you know but i was looking into smaler fish and I really like the neon gobies. there is one petco, that is sooo tiny. Has anyone had one of these? Are the easy to care for and feed? Will they be fine in a reef tank or do they put sand every where? The one at petco never is in he sand, but is all ways roaming the rocks.

They don't mess with the sand. They are one of my favorites. They will even preform cleaning services to other fish! The ones at Petco are captive raised as well!!!

I added a neon goby to a tank with a blue dot jawfish yesterday. The jawfish ate it after about 2 seconds in the tank. The goby tried to swim out of its mouth a few times before it became an expensive snack.

I have one in my 90 gallon. He has a cave and is guarenteed to be there every night. During the day he swims around the rock as well as cleaning every fish in my tank. They actually wait in line to be cleaned next
